The 2012 Frontier generally did not come with a factory-installed cabin air filter in the U.S. market.
There are occasional regional differences or dealer-installed options that could include a cabin air filter, but it was not standard on most 2012 Frontiers. If you want to verify for your specific truck, you should check the glove box area and consult the owner's manual or a Nissan parts diagram for your VIN.

How to check if your 2012 Frontier has a cabin air filter
Use these steps to inspect the HVAC intake area and glove box area to determine if a cabin air filter is present and accessible for replacement.
- Open the glove box and look for a rectangular access panel or a filter housing behind it. In many Nissan models, you must lower or remove the glove box to reach the filter.
- Inspect for a pleated filter sitting in a plastic frame; verify that there are clips or a cover securing it and that airflow arrows on the filter indicate the proper direction.
- If you can locate a filter and housing, your Frontier has a cabin air filter installed. If there is no housing or no filter behind the glove box, there is likely no cabin air filter on that vehicle.
- For certainty, reference the VIN-specific parts diagram or the owner's manual, as regional variations can occur.
Conclusion: Checking behind the glove box is the most reliable way to confirm whether a cabin air filter exists on your 2012 Frontier.
